Dining In or Taking Out: How to Earn Seated Rewards
By simply booking a table or ordering a takeaway via the Seated app, you collect appetizing rewards. Browse through partner restaurants, reserve your seat for a gastronomic adventure, and once the meal is relished and the bill settled, snap a pic of your receipt. Upload this memento of your culinary journey to the app to receive your promised indulgences.

Clear imagery is the secret sauce here – a blurry receipt photo might just leave a bitter taste with no rewards credited. Remember, using third-party delivery services like Grubhub or UberEats is a no-go – Seated detests side dishes from competitors.
The Art of Referrals: Making Money by Sharing
Seated's referral program is quite the cherry on top. Share your unique referral link, and once your friends join and earn their first reward by uploading a dining receipt, it's payday for you - up to $35, depending on their spendings!
For the social butterflies with a minimum of five dined-and-earned referrals, there's a sweet 5% commission on your referrals' future earnings. You couldn't ask for a more palatable passive income dish!
The Great Seated Payout: Is It a Rewarding Feast?
While Seated won't stuff your wallet with cold hard cash, it lavishes your digital pocket with points redeemable for gift cards from popular destinations like Amazon and Target. Just a $5 accrual in your Seated piggy bank allows you to claim a tasty treat in gift card form.
It's a straightforward, user-friendly system, albeit one with a cashless conclusion that might turn off those with a palate refined for monetary munchies.
The Earning Potential: A Gourmet or Fast Food Experience?
Your location and frequency of dining out at Seated-affiliated restaurants determine the garnish on your earning platter. Most establishments dish out rewards between 5% to 20% of your bill - a sumptuous rate by any epicurean's standards.
The caveat? Many of these eateries lean toward the upscale. If your budget is more burger joint than white linen, Seated's menu of partner restaurants may leave you feeling unsatisfied.
Mobile vs. Desktop: Where Does Seated Serve Best?
Seated is a mobile affair, meant to be savored on the go. You can peruse restaurants on a desktop, but for the full five-star experience and to make reservations, the mobile app is your maitre d'.

Thankfully, Android and iOS users can both indulge in Seated's offerings, ensuring there are no tech-based dietary restrictions.
Geographic Culinary Limitations: Is Seated in Your City?
Seated's delectable deals are currently up for grabs in select U.S. cities - New York, Dallas, Boston, Atlanta, Chicago, and Philadelphia, with a promise of expanding to other locales on the horizon.
